Common Indications of Roofing Damages



When you examine your roof, look closely for common indicators of damage that can cause larger issues later on.


Beginning by looking for missing or cracked tiles; these can permit water to seep in and trigger leaks. Take note of granule loss, which can show that shingles are maturing and shedding their protective layer.

Next, take a look at the blinking around smokeshafts and vents. If you detect corrosion or gaps, water can conveniently enter your home.

Search for sagging areas on the roof covering, as this could signal architectural damages or the buildup of wetness.

Don't fail to remember to check for moss or algae development; while they could appear safe, they can catch dampness and increase deterioration.

Evaluate the gutters for debris and indicators of water overflow, as this can show an obstruction or inappropriate drainage.

Ultimately, watch on your ceilings and wall surfaces for water discolorations or peeling off paint, as these could be clues that your roofing is dripping.

Dealing with these indicators promptly can aid you prevent much more significant fixings and extend the life expectancy of your roof.

Inspecting Your Roofing Routinely



Regular roofing system examinations are vital for maintaining the integrity of your home. By keeping a close eye on your roof, you can catch problems early, conserving yourself time and money in the long run. Aim to check your roof covering at least two times a year-- as soon as in the spring and once in the loss. This timing assists you address any type of damage brought on by winter weather and get ready for the forthcoming periods.

When evaluating, start from the ground. Use field glasses to look for missing out on tiles, fractured floor tiles, or any kind of signs of wear. Look for drooping locations or dark areas, which might indicate leakages. Don't fail to remember to examine the seamless gutters, as stopped up or broken seamless gutters can lead to water accumulation and roofing damages.

If you fit, climb to the roofing to obtain a closer look. Take notice of flashing around smokeshafts and vents, as these areas are prone to leakages. Be cautious and ensure you have a secure way to access your roofing system.

Regular maintenance, like cleaning up debris and moss, will likewise aid extend your roof covering's life expectancy. Remaining aggressive about evaluations can help you detect covert issues prior to they intensify.

When to Call a Professional



Usually, property owners wait to call an expert for roofing problems, believing they can handle repairs themselves. Nonetheless, recognizing when to look for assistance can conserve you time, cash, and stress and anxiety. If you discover substantial leaks, comprehensive water damages, or dark places on your ceilings, don't wait. These indicators might indicate major underlying troubles that call for experienced focus.

If your roof covering is older than twenty years, also minor concerns can rise promptly. Split shingles, missing tiles, or drooping areas are warnings that warrant an expert inspection.

Furthermore, if you're uneasy climbing onto your roofing or lack the needed devices and experience, it's finest to leave it to the pros.

When tornado damages takes place, such as hailstorm or high winds, it's essential to obtain an analysis from a certified professional. They can recognize concealed problems that could jeopardize your home's stability.

Ultimately, if you've attempted repair work but the trouble lingers, don't be reluctant to employ an expert. They'll bring the expertise and skills needed to guarantee your roof is secure.
